The importance of temperature while vaping

Temperature is crucial to the vaping experience. The temperature directly impacts the amount of vapor produced. If you want to minimize vapor, stick within the lower range of temperatures. However, if you like the effect of a large vapor cloud, go ahead and turn up the heat.

Lower temperatures help preserve your materials, ensure that the vapor is rich and flavorful, and support a more discreet experience by decreasing the smell and generating small vapor clouds. Additionally, low temperatures can improve the taste and aroma of your cannabis.

Higher temperatures support large vapor clouds and typically result in bitterness. Choose the temperature that best supports the experience you want to have.

What are the PAX 2 & PAX 3 temperature settings?

PAX 2 & PAX 3 supports a temperature range from 360°F from 420°F. You can access four temperature presets by pushing down on the mouthpiece. The four-petal LED indicator will change color depending on the selected preset.

  • 360°F: The lowest of the four presets is represented by one green petal on the LED indicator.
  • 380°F: This setting is represented by two yellow petals on the LED indicator.
  • 400°F: Three orange petals will light up when this temperature setting is selected.
  • 420°F: The highest temperature setting is represented by four red petals.

    How long does PAX Device take to heat?

    PAX 3’s heat-up time depends on the temperature you select, but overall, heat-up time has been reduced significantly from previous models.

    PAX 3 heats in approximately 22 seconds. By comparison, the PAX 2 takes approximately 45 seconds to heat. PAX 3 may reach the selected temperature faster when a lower setting is selected, while it may take longer if you wish to use your vaporizer on its highest-allowable temperature. No matter which setting you select, a quick vibration will notify you when PAX 3 is properly heated and ready to use.

    What to consider when selecting your temperature

    Now that we’ve established the importance of vaping temperature, you can decide which temperature is best for the type of experience you want to have. Keep these factors in mind while finding your PAX 3 sweet spot:

    • Flavor: Do you want to taste the finer notes of the cannabis material being vaporized? Consider keeping the temperature in the 360°F range.
    • Material preservation: Lower temperatures tend to consume your cannabis material at a lower rate, so if you want to maximize what’s packed in the PAX 3’s oven, keep your temperature on the lower end of the spectrum.
    • Vapor production and vapor quality: Higher temperatures produce larger clouds and more dense vapor.
